What is Vibe Coding?
Vibe coding represents the evolution beyond traditional pair programming or collaborative coding. It's characterized by:
- Flow-state programming environments that minimize context switching
- AI-assisted collaboration that feels like working with an intelligent co-pilot
- Real-time synchronization across team members without communication barriers
- Intuitive interfaces that reduce cognitive load and technical friction
- Multi-modal inputs (voice, text, visual) for expressing development ideas

GitHub Copilot Workspace
Building on the success of GitHub Copilot, GitHub Copilot Workspace has evolved into a comprehensive collaborative environment that leverages Microsoft's advanced AI models.
Key Features:
- AI-Powered Code Generation: Built on Microsoft and OpenAI's latest models
- Intelligent Version Control: Advanced Git integration with AI-assisted merge conflict resolution
- Built-in Planning and Spec Tools: Automated project planning based on natural language inputs
- Comprehensive Testing Integration: Automated test generation and validation
- Seamless GitHub Ecosystem Connection: Native integration with all GitHub tools
Strengths:
- Mature Ecosystem: Leverages the extensive GitHub infrastructure
- Enterprise Readiness: Advanced security, compliance, and governance features
- Large User Base: Extensive community support and resources
- Advanced AI Capabilities: Among the most sophisticated AI coding assistants
Limitations:
- Complexity: Steeper learning curve for new users
- Cost: Higher price point for full feature access
- GitHub Dependency: Less flexible for teams using alternative version control systems
Replit

Replit has transformed from a collaborative coding platform into a complete AI-powered development environment with its Ghostwriter technology.
Key Features:
- Browser-Based Development: Zero local setup required
- Ghostwriter AI: Context-aware code generation and assistance
- One-Click Deployment: Instant hosting and sharing of applications
- Educational Features: Specialized tools for learning and teaching
- Real-time Collaboration: Multiple developers can work simultaneously
Strengths:
- Accessibility: Extremely low barrier to entry
- Deploy-to-Share Speed: Fastest path from code to shareable application
- Education Focus: Excellent for learning environments
- Community: Active educational and developer community
Limitations:
- Professional Tooling: Less robust for large-scale enterprise development
- Performance: Browser limitations for computation-heavy projects
- Customization: Less flexible for specialized development environments
Qodo (formerly Codium)
Recently rebranded from Codium to Qodo, this platform has gained attention for its quality-first approach to AI-assisted development.
Key Features:
- Vibe Coding Support: Explicitly designed for collaborative flow-state programming
- Test-Driven Development: AI-powered test generation and validation
- IDE Integration: Seamless integration with VS Code and JetBrains
- PR-Focused Tooling: Specialized tools for code review and pull requests
- Multi-Agent Experience: Coordinated AI assistants for different development tasks
Strengths:
- Code Quality Focus: Emphasis on maintainable, well-tested code
- Developer Experience: Designed to enhance existing workflows rather than replace them
- Universal Language Support: Works with virtually all programming languages
- Integration Strategy: Works within existing toolchains rather than replacing them
Limitations:
- Limited Web Interface: Primary focus on IDE plugins rather than standalone experience
- Learning Curve: Initial setup requires some configuration for optimal results
- Less All-in-One: Focused on specific parts of the development lifecycle
Windsurf by Codeium
Windsurf offers a browser-based, AI-powered development environment built on the foundations of VS Code.
Key Features:
- Supercomplete: Context-aware code completion across the entire workspace
- Ephemeral Workspaces: Instantly spinnable development environments
- Cascade: Intelligent workspace understanding for better suggestions
- Real-time Collaboration: Seamless multi-user editing and reviewing
- VS Code Foundation: Familiar experience for VS Code users
Strengths:
- Workspace Understanding: Superior context awareness across project files
- Familiar Interface: Low learning curve for VS Code users
- Speed: Fast workspace creation and operation
- Flexibility: Adapts to various development workflows
Limitations:
- Newer Offering: Still establishing market presence
- Enterprise Features: Less robust enterprise integration compared to GitHub options
- Advanced Customization: Limited compared to local IDE setups
